How Important Is Video Resolution in a Car Camera?
Video resolution is very important in a car camera. Higher video resolution improves clarity and detail. A camera with high resolution captures more pixels, providing sharper images. This helps in identifying license plates, street signs, and faces in case of an incident.
Common resolutions for car cameras include 1080p, 1440p, and 4K. The 1080p resolution offers good quality and is often sufficient for most users. The 1440p resolution provides better detail, which can be beneficial for legal evidence. The 4K resolution offers the highest quality, delivering exceptionally clear footage. However, 4K cameras may require more storage space and processing power.
Additionally, low-light performance is also crucial. Higher resolution cameras usually perform better in low-light conditions. Good low-light performance ensures that the footage remains usable at night or in dimly lit areas.
In summary, video resolution significantly affects the performance of a car camera. Higher resolutions lead to clearer, more detailed images, which can be vital for safety and legal matters. Choosing the right resolution depends on individual needs and how one intends to use the footage.

How Does Night Vision Enhance the Functionality of a Car Camera?
Night vision enhances the functionality of a car camera by improving visibility in low-light conditions. It achieves this by using infrared technology to detect heat emitted by objects. This process allows the camera to create a clearer image even when there is minimal ambient light.
The main components involved are infrared sensors and image processing algorithms. The infrared sensors capture heat signatures, while the image processing algorithms convert these signals into visible images.
In low-light situations, traditional cameras often produce grainy images, making it difficult for drivers to see obstacles or pedestrians. Night vision technology reduces this issue by providing clearer and more detailed images, enabling safer driving at night.
Furthermore, night vision systems can enhance features like collision detection and lane departure warnings. The added clarity from night vision allows these systems to function accurately in darkness.
In summary, night vision technology improves car cameras by ensuring enhanced visibility, improved safety, and more reliable functionality during nighttime driving.

- Installation Steps:
The installation steps of car cameras are crucial for ensuring optimal performance. First, selecting an appropriate mounting location is vital. Mounting the camera in a position that provides a clear view without obstructing the driver’s view is important. Next, cleaning and preparing the surface ensures better adhesion and accuracy. After positioning, you will connect the power supply securely, typically to the vehicle’s fuse box or accessory port. Lastly, angle adjustment is essential to ensure the camera captures desired footage, whether it be front facing or rear-view.
Expert opinions vary on DIY installation versus professional services. DIY enthusiasts claim it saves money and allows customization, while professional installers guarantee proper setup and warranty coverage for any defects or issues.
- Maintenance Tips:
The maintenance tips for car cameras focus on extending their lifespan and enhancing their functionality. Regularly checking camera angles ensures that your footage captures the intended view without any obstructions. Cleaning lenses frequently allows for clear recordings, as dirt and grime can hinder quality, especially in adverse weather. Verifying firmware updates is critical, as manufacturers frequently provide updates to enhance features or fix bugs. Lastly, inspecting wiring and connections prevents issues, such as electrical failures or malfunctions that can disrupt camera functionality.
